Rosberg: We have a lot of homework to do

World championship leader Nico Rosberg wound up third in Friday’s second free practice at the Mexican Grand Prix and said he faced “a lot of homework to do” to improve his performance on Saturday. The German was four-tenths of a second off the pace set by fastest man Sebastian Vettel of Ferrari and his Mercedes teammate defending three-time champion Lewis Hamilton. “It’s been an unusual day out there,” said Rosberg, who is 26 points clear of Hamilton with three races remaining. “The low temperatures and a very green track. “So, its been a bit of a steep learning curve to understand what to do with the tyres – how to get the best out of them and also the long runs....
